| Period | Form | Revenue | Net income | Operating margin |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| FY 2025 | 10-K | $114.2M | $-969.6M | — |
| FY 2024 | 10-K | $15.6M | $-685.9M | — |
| FY 2023 | 10-K | $16.4M | $-229.5M | — |
| FY 2022 | 10-K | $17.9M | $-229.8M | — |
| FY 2021 | 10-K | $4.6M | $-124.2M | — |
| FY 2020 | 10-K | $219.0K | $-70.6M | — |
